Comprehending Wagering Odds


Wagering odds are a critical aspect in the world of football betting, as they indicate the likelihood of a particular outcome happening in a game. Odds are typically presented in 3 formats: decimal, ratio, and American. Each format fulfills the same purpose but is applied in various regions or by multiple betting platforms. Comprehending how to interpret these odds can considerably enhance your betting experience and help you make informed decisions.


When you come across numeric odds, they indicate how much you might earn for each unit wagered, including your stake. For example, if you bet on a team with decimal odds of 2.00, you will double your money if that team wins. On the flip side, fractional odds represent the profit you can make in relation to your stake. If you see odds of 5/1, this means you could win five times your stake for a successful bet. Lastly, American odds, which can be either plus or negative, show how much profit you can earn on a $100 bet or how much you need to bet to win $100, conversely.


The analysis of these odds helps you to discern not only potential winnings, but also the suggested probabilities of various outcomes. For instance, lower odds usually indicate a higher probability of winning, while higher odds suggest an underdog status. By understanding these implications, fans can better assess risk and make strategic betting choices suited to their insights about teams and matches.


Types of Football Bets


As we discuss betting on football matches, understanding the types of bets that exist is essential for maximizing your chances of success. The most prevalent bet is the moneyline bet, in which you simply pick the team you believe will win the game. This simple approach appeals to many fans, as it allows for an effortless decision without considering point spreads or additional complexities.


A different popular option is the point spread bet. In this type of betting, one team is preferred over the other, and the odds indicate this discrepancy. The favored team must win by a specific number of points for a bet on them to be successful, while the underdog may win outright or lose by fewer points than the spread. This type of bet introduces an additional dimension of excitement and strategy, as bettors need to analyze team showings and matchups closely.


Lastly, there are total bets, also known as over/under bets. Here, you wager on the total score of the two teams in the game. Efficient Bankroll Management


One of the key factors of attaining long-term success while you bet on football games is proper bankroll management. This practice involves defining a specific budget for how much money you are prepared to allocate for betting pursuits and holding to it. By establishing a set bankroll, you can avoid hasty decisions and ensure that you make wise bets without exposing more than you can afford to sacrifice. Maintaining a dedicated account or using allocated funds can help maintain discipline.


Another important aspect of bankroll management is determining the size of your bets. A common recommendation is to only bet a small percentage of your total bankroll on a single wager, typically between one and 5 percent. This method helps secure your funds from large losses and allows for the certain ups and downs of betting. By altering your bet size based on your current bankroll, you can remain in the game for a longer time and enhance your chances of recovering from losing streaks.


In conclusion, tracking your betting performance is crucial for managing your bankroll successfully. By upholding detailed records of your bets, including consequences and the rationale behind each decision, you can evaluate your results over time. This evaluation will help you refine your strategies and make required adjustments to improve your chances of success when you bet on football games. Frequent review encourages responsibility and helps spot patterns that could inform better betting strategies in the future.
